Can V8 Be Used for Cooking?

V8 is a vegetable juice made by the Campbell Soup Company. It is composed of eight vegetables, including tomatoes, carrots, celery, lettuce, beets, parsley, watercress, and spinach. V8 can be used for cooking as it adds a natural sweetness and savoriness to dishes.

Additionally, the vitamins and minerals present in V8 can help boost the nutritional value of meals. For example, adding V8 to soup or pasta sauce can increase the amount of antioxidants and vitamins A and C.

Award Winning Chili With V8 Juice

This chili recipe is a winner! It’s easy to make and full of flavor. The V8 juice adds a nice depth of flavor and the beans provide a hearty texture.

Serve this chili with some shredded cheese and sour cream on top. Ingredients: 1 pound ground beef

1 onion, diced 1 green pepper, diced 2 cloves garlic, minced

1 can (15 ounces) diced tomatoes, undrained

READ MORE RELATED   Macaroni Grill Chicken Scallopini Recipe
1 can (15 ounces) kidney beans, undrained 3/4 cup V8 juice

1 tablespoon chili powder 1 teaspoon ground cumin 1/2 teaspoon salt 1/4 teaspoon black pepper Instructions: In a large pot over medium heat, cook the beef until it is browned.

Drain any excess fat and add the onions, green peppers, garlic, tomatoes, kidney beans, V8 juice, chili powder, cumin, salt and black pepper. Stir well and bring to a boil. Reduce the heat to low and simmer for 30 minutes to allow the flavors to blend.
